LOONA ViVi, HyunJin File Injunctions For Contract Suspension With BlockBerry Creative

On February 3, BlockBerry Creative confirmed that the reports of LOONA ViVi and HyunJin filing injunctions are true.

Sources have reported that the two members plans to suspend their contracts with the agency.

In the aftershock of Chuu's removal from the group on November 2022, nine LOONA members filed injunctions for contract suspension, except for ViVi and Hyunjin. On the earlier reports, BlockBerry Creative denied the claims.

On January, media reported that LOONA members HeeJin, Kim Lip, JinSoul, and Choerry have won their lawsuits against BlockBerry Creative.

It was also revealed that while the four members snagged their victory, five other members had lost, according to the Seoul Northern District Court Civil Division 1.

Sources state that ViVi and Hyunjin's contracts will contain the same terms as the four suspended contracts, to which winning the lawsuits can be considered as plausible.

Furthermore, BlockBerry Creative has submitted a petition requesting for Chuu's suspension in entertainment activities. It was filed on December 2022.

False Reports Taking it Too Far? Chuu Shares Thoughts on Instagram

In other news, Chuu expressed her own take regarding online reports, to which she claimed false news. On February 2, former LOONA member Chuu caught netizens' attention online due to her Instagram Story.

Chuu addressed the ongoing issue, which involved BlockBerry Creative filing an entertainment-activity suspending petition, and their claims of the idol violating a contract segment.

For further context, the agency asserted that Chuu had "tampered" a portion of the agreement, by saying the idol had made early contact with BY4M Studio in 2021. Since Chuu has been removed in the group, the idol decided to transfer to a new agency.

Upon seeing the reports, Chuu imparted her frustration on the allegations. She stated the information scattered across the internet have gone too far, and that she didn't know BY4M Studio back in December 2021.

Chuu was also distressed seeing LOONA members get embroiled with the reports. The idol said that she will first organize her thoughts on the matter, and release further announcement soon.

See Chuu's full statement below:

"Hello. This is Chuu speaking. I want to let everyone know that it's really exhausting and sad that I'm repeatedly disclosing the entirety of my position."

"On the latest information that spread online, I've seen dozens of articles with slanderous nature, as it's also based on false reports. Honestly, I didn't even know the agency BY4M back in December 2021."

"It's really difficult for me to witness LOONA members get involved with the lies created recently. So, in order to settle this, I will arrange my position first regarding the claims, and give my response soon."
